A review will consider reducing the “volume of assessment” at GCSE following concerns about the pressure that exams can place on pupils. The review said it will ensure the curriculum is ...
This may mean it eventually recommends fewer GCSE exams overall. Maths and English are required subjects for GCSE-level students, and currently, if students fail their exam they have to do a resit.
